Product Description
Children will not only improve their reading skills with this lively new book, but also begin to recognize basic and important math concepts. Rabbit and Hare Divide an Apple playfully introduces the idea that a whole can be divided into different sized parts. Simple vocabulary and plenty of visual clues makes this book perfect for young children who are just starting to read by themselves, while math activities give them the chance to use the concepts from each book.

This is a brightly colored level 1 easy-to-read book that encourages children to think about division and how to divide items evenly. The rabbit and the hare try to divide a mushroom into equal parts without success. The raccoon intervenes and eats the mushroom. They try again with an apple, but it is not divided in equal parts either. The raccoon offers to help again but rabbit and hare are wiser and decline his help. Rabbit and hare devise a plan to cut the larger and smaller pieces of the apple into equal parts. I would recommend this book to help children start to understand division and apply it to real life situations.
